All Session Tracks

Track 01
Innovative Metrics for Sustainable Development

This track focuses on the development and application of novel metrics that enhance the assessment of sustainable development. Participants will explore innovative approaches to measuring progress towards sustainability goals across various sectors.

Track 02
Environmental Monitoring and Performance Measurement

This session will delve into methodologies for environmental monitoring that inform performance measurement in sustainability initiatives. Emphasis will be placed on integrating data-driven approaches to evaluate environmental impacts effectively.

Track 03
SDG Indicators: Challenges and Opportunities

This track will examine the challenges and opportunities associated with the implementation of Sustainable Development Goal (SDG) indicators. Discussions will focus on best practices for data collection, analysis, and reporting to enhance global sustainability efforts.

Track 04
Life-Cycle Assessment in Sustainable Practices

Participants will explore the role of life-cycle assessment (LCA) in evaluating the sustainability of products and services. This session aims to highlight case studies that demonstrate the effectiveness of LCA in driving sustainable decision-making.

Track 05
Ecological Footprint and Resource Efficiency

This track will investigate the ecological footprint as a critical indicator of resource efficiency in various industries. Presentations will focus on strategies for minimizing ecological impacts while maximizing resource utilization.

Track 06
Corporate Sustainability Reporting and Accountability

This session will address the importance of corporate sustainability reporting in promoting transparency and accountability. Participants will discuss frameworks and standards that guide effective reporting practices in corporate sustainability.

Track 07
Climate Adaptation Metrics: Measuring Resilience

This track will explore metrics that assess climate adaptation strategies and their effectiveness in enhancing resilience. Participants will share insights on developing indicators that reflect adaptive capacity in vulnerable communities.

Track 08
Social Indicators in Sustainable Development

This session will focus on the integration of social indicators into sustainable development frameworks. Discussions will highlight the importance of social equity and community well-being in achieving sustainability goals.

Track 09
Governance Metrics for Sustainable Policy Evaluation

This track will examine governance metrics that facilitate the evaluation of sustainability policies. Participants will explore frameworks that assess the effectiveness of governance structures in promoting sustainable development.

Track 10
Energy Metrics for Sustainable Solutions

This session will focus on the development of energy metrics that support the transition to sustainable energy solutions. Discussions will include innovative approaches to measuring energy efficiency and renewable energy adoption.

Track 11
Water Metrics and Sustainable Resource Management

This track will investigate metrics related to water resource management in the context of sustainable development. Participants will share methodologies for assessing water use efficiency and the impacts of water policies on sustainability.
